Array Inc. is a network functions platform company. The Company is engaged in network hyperconverged infrastructure (N-HCI) business. The Company develops purpose-built systems for deploying virtual app delivery, networking and security functions. The Company and its subsidiaries mainly engaged in the research, manufacturing and sale of application delivery controllers, high-end secure sockets layer virtual private network (SSL VPN) systems, remote desktop access solutions, application acceleration and wide area network (WAN) optimization controllers. Its application delivery and security products, such as the application delivery controllers (ADCs), and SSL VPN are available in both cloud and virtual versions, as well as a dedicated hardware version, to assist business users in improving the performance, availability, security and connectivity to applications. Its subsidiaries include Array Networks, Inc., Zentry Security Inc., Array Networks Japan Kabishiki Kaisha and others.
